Discovering the Heart of Costa Rica: A Day with Palo Verde Boat Tours

Drawn by the promise of wildlife and authentic Costa Rican culture, I embarked on the Palo Verde Boat Tour in Ortega. The experience was a delightful blend of nature, hospitality, and culinary delights.

A Warm Welcome in Ortega

As a seasoned traveler and surfer, I’ve had my fair share of adventures across Central America, but the allure of the Palo Verde Boat Tours in Ortega was something I couldn’t resist. The promise of a wildlife safari combined with a taste of authentic Costa Rican culture was too tempting to pass up. Upon arrival, I was greeted by the warm and welcoming Patricia, or Patty as she insisted I call her. Her genuine hospitality set the tone for the day, and I immediately felt like part of the family.

The tour began with a refreshing glass of homemade juice, a delightful start to what promised to be an unforgettable experience. Patty introduced us to the local way of life, sharing stories of the region and its people. We were treated to a demonstration of traditional tortilla-making, a skill passed down through generations. Watching Tita, the tortilla maestro, work her magic was mesmerizing, and tasting the freshly made tortillas with a dollop of cream and cheese was a culinary revelation.

A Journey Through Nature

The real adventure began as we embarked on our private boat tour along the Tempisque River. Felix, our knowledgeable guide, navigated the waters with ease, pointing out the diverse wildlife that called this region home. The sight of monkeys swinging through the trees and the vibrant birdlife was a feast for the eyes. As someone who spends a lot of time in the ocean, it was a refreshing change to be surrounded by such lush greenery and wildlife.

Patty’s presence on the tour added a personal touch, as she shared anecdotes and ensured we had ample opportunities to capture the perfect photograph. The tour was unhurried, allowing us to fully immerse ourselves in the natural beauty of the Palo Verde National Park. The highlight for me was the sheer number of monkeys we encountered, their playful antics providing endless entertainment.

A Taste of Costa Rican Hospitality

After the boat tour, we returned to the family-run base for a hearty lunch. The meal was a celebration of Costa Rican flavors, lovingly prepared by Patty’s mother and daughters. Each dish was a testament to the family’s commitment to using locally sourced ingredients, and the result was nothing short of spectacular. The fruit water, a favorite of my fellow travelers, was the perfect accompaniment to the meal.

The experience was more than just a tour; it was an immersion into the heart of Costa Rican culture. The warmth and hospitality of the family, combined with the stunning natural surroundings, made for a day that I will cherish for years to come.
